Washington: Over 96 US lawmakers boycotted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u's address to the joint session of Congress during his visit to the United States.
Those who chose not to attend Netanyahu's address include US Democratic Presidential nominee Kamala Harris.
Even many of those who attended were critical of the Israeli Prime Minister due to unabated Israeli military aggression against innocent Palestinians.
The only Palestinian-American lawmaker, Representative Rashida Tlaib attended the address by doning a traditional Palestinian keffiyeh, holding a sign reading 'war criminal' on one side, and 'guilty of genocide' on the other.
